Report: Cubs’ Top Pitcher Hit with Devastating Injury News

On Thursday, the Chicago Cubs received tough news about a bullpen pitcher, Adbert Alzolay, who has been placed on the 60-day injured list due to a right flexor strain. According to MLB.com, he is likely to require surgery, effectively ending his season. Alzolay, who hasn’t pitched since May 12 while attempting to rehab the injury, is now sidelined for the remainder of the season.

Before his injury, Alzolay was struggling, posting a 4.67 ERA over 17.1 innings pitched. In 2023, however, he had a standout season with a 2.67 ERA and a 165 ERA+, closing games for the Cubs with 22 saves in 58 appearances. He was expected to play a significant role in the Cubs bullpen this season.

To fill Alzolay’s spot, the Cubs acquired Tyson Miller in May. Miller has been exceptional, recording a 1.73 ERA and a 206 ERA+ in 25 appearances. His performance will be crucial if the Cubs hope to make the playoffs.

During the MLB trade deadline, Chicago made significant moves, acquiring infielder Isaac Paredes from the Rays for multiple prospects and trading reliever Mark Leiter Jr. to the Yankees. Paredes is now a key part of the Cubs’ infield, but the team remains in a precarious position as the National League Wild Card race heats up.

The Cubs have only a 5.8% chance of making the playoffs, according to Fangraphs, as they are six games out of the Wild Card with recent struggles. Since the All-Star break, the Cubs have gone 6-6, losing ground to competitors like the San Diego Padres, New York Mets, Arizona Diamondbacks, and San Francisco Giants, who hold the top records in the National League.

In the division, the Milwaukee Brewers lead the National League Central, six games ahead of the St. Louis Cardinals, with a 75.5% chance of winning the division. The Cubs are in last place, nine and a half games behind the Brewers.

While Isaac Paredes adds a new dynamic to the lineup, the Cubs face long odds to make the playoffs. With Alzolay’s season-ending injury and other teams in better form, their chances remain slim. However, with their top players returning in 2025, the Cubs could be a strong contender for the National League Wild Card next year.
